Output 8b89ec64951cbbe2b281a1476d60d0982434260e25beade18ad4e496e9716afd:4

value
2960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be2e98cf73f3c603c2fa91fe4f3059270897b64 OP_EQUAL
address
38cGS5H1GfAQAmBKsqQNvpmcNAxJ1Bqs5T
transaction
8b89ec64951cbbe2b281a1476d60d0982434260e25beade18ad4e496e9716afd
spent
true